Your role responsibilities:
* Responsible for monitoring and managing stock levels, ensuring a steady supply of goods to meet customer demand while minimizing holding costs
* Using stock replenishing system to order new stock
* Analysing demand and production requirements ensuring the timely availability of products
* Communicating with suppliers to track orders, confirm delivery dates, resolve discrepancies, expediting urgent orders, and taking proactive measures to resolve stock-related issues
* Accurately maintaining Item records in ERP system
* Responsible for managing supplier relationship, monitor current & past performance, identify underperformance, and seeking for continuous improvements
* Track slow-moving, non-moving, and aged stock; analyse underlying causes and recommend appropriate solutions
